Country / jurisdiction: Japan · Year: 1992 · Status: In force · Level: National · Type: Voluntary

The law regulates the export, import, transportation and disposal of specified hazardous and other wastes and implements the Basel Convention on the Control of Transboundary Movements of Hazardous Wastes and Their Disposal.

Some key provisions are set out below:

Specified hazardous and other wastes are defined with reference to the Annexures of the Basel Convention.

Any person who imports or exports specified hazardous and other wastes is required to obtain approval under the Foreign Exchange and Foreign Trade Act .

The transported waste is required to be accompanied by related movement documents

When imported wastes have been disposed of, the exporter or the competent authorities of the region of origin, shipment or transit are to be notified

The Minister of Economy, Trade and Industry and the Minister of the Environment have the power to issue orders for exporters, importers, transporters of specified hazardous wastes to take necessary measures to prevent damage to human health and the environment, including measures for recovering or properly disposing of the specified hazardous wastes.
